The long awaited Sugar, premiered at 2008 Sundance, finally comes to the U.S. The Dominican baseball drama from writer-directors Ryan Fleck and Anna Boden (Half Nelson) follows the story of Miguel Santos, a.k.a. Azucar, a Dominican pitcher from San Pedro de Macoris, under pressure to make it to the big leagues and pull himself and his family out of poverty. Playing professionally at the Kansas City Knights baseball academy, Miguel finally gets his break at age 19 when he advances to the United States’ minor league system. As Miguel grapples with the new language and culture, despite the welcoming efforts of his host family, he is faced with an isolation he never before experienced. When his play on the mound falters, he begins questioning more closely the world around him and his place within it, and ultimately examine the single-mindedness of his life’s ambition.
